Title: Backup Wallet
Post by: happyonlife on June 18, 2011, 04:02 pm
Would it be possible to add a field to our accounts in SR for a backup wallet?

That way if the site goes down for awhile or permanently, you can release the bitcoins to your user's backup bitcoin wallets?  This could make people a little less nervous about holding too many bitcoins on SR.
